Soil: Heterogeneous soils; predominantly composed of sand, gravel and abundant pebbles. Certain sectors contain calcareous and clay-rich components mixed with gravel and larger stones.
Production Methods: Produced from a selection of centenary pre-phylloxera vineyards and younger trellised Verdejo vineyards. The old-vine component is fermented and aged in French oak barrels and foudres, while the trellised vineyards are vinified in stainless steel tanks to preserve varietal purity and freshness. Following fermentation, both components remain on their fine lees for approximately eight months, either in oak vessels or stainless-steel tanks, with regular monitoring and tasting throughout the ageing period. Once the desired balance between complexity, texture and freshness has been achieved, the different components are blended and harmonized before undergoing gentle clarification and filtration prior to bottling. Approximately 8 months on fine lees, partially in French oak barrels and foudres and partially in stainless steel tanks.
